Sass & Bide Spring/Summer 2012 Lookbook

Invest in fabulous unexpected pieces this summer to be able to stand out relatively effortlessly. Check out the latest Sass & Bide spring/summer 2012 lookbook for outfit inspiration to expand your array of choices and look spectacular.

Carefree style is a perfect match for warm spring and summer days, so it is natural to see a multitude of outfits that cater to our need for exciting effortless alternatives. The Australian fashion retailer Sass& Bide is definitely on board for fulfilling such requests with eclectic and creative attire choices meant to be slightly obscure yet beautiful, with a vision for attention grabbing options that don't necessarily follow the style direction set in the previous seasons.

The new face of the brand, Nicole Pollard, reflects the new found idea of the brand with ease and looks absolutely stunning while doing so. Different silhouettes, styles, fabrics and textures are skillfully blended together into fab choices that are bold yet comfy. Watercolor polka dots, floral prints, embroidery and unexpected neoprene inserts are some of the most interesting elements that are found in many of the style alternative suggestions.






Metallic tones, leather and vinyl or denim might seem like unlikely combos, however the choices presented manage to be quite chic and alluring. Asymmetry can also add a touch of edginess, so such elements are also included for a greater versatility and increased wow factor possibility. With a mix of classy, easy to mix and match pieces and hot-off-the-runway like pieces, the latest collection can appeal to several types of shoppers and style perspectives. Keeping an adequate balance between the two is part of the charm of the latest lookbook.

Although outfits as a whole are exciting enough, certain pieces tend to land quite easily on our must have list: fab jackets, bold cut dresses, striped patterned pieces and funky shorts are fabulous examples of pieces that can spice up your new season outfits with a relatively low amount of effort. The statement value of such pieces can definitely be useful when you are not in the mood of engaging in elaborate layering style rules and the like.
